I would ditch it pre-flop at most if not all 6-handed tables and many 5-handed tables -- but this is 4-handed and I think it's close / good. His stats seem to indicate that he knows what he's doing in a very general and broad fashion, and if that's the case then his range is really wide 4-handed.

I think pre-flop is close but I'd be three-betting more often than folding. I think your post-flop play is good. When he calls the flop, I think it generally means he's seeing a SD absent a [img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img] (which could produce a fold or a raise); thus I think a turn bet has little fold equity and putting in 2 on the turn blows. When he bets the river after you check, I think his range shrinks sufficiently that you should fold. Specific reads on his post-flop tendencies might make me want to bet the turn or take a different river line, but absent those reads this looks good to me.
